New Jenoptik spot speed cameras welcomed in Cornwall

Two new speed cameras have been installed by Jenoptik on a busy stretch of the A390 in Cornwall, with the immediate effect on traffic already making a councillor feel “euphoric”. Positioned at either end of St Ann’s Chapel, the cameras are bi-directional, meaning they will detect speeding motorists travelling on both sides of the road. […]

Upgrade to Greater Manchester’s speed camera network getting underway

Transport for Greater Manchester (TfGM) has signed a contract with Jenoptik UK to upgrade almost a hundred spot speed cameras across the region with state-of-the-art technology to help improve road safety. Funded through the Mayor’s Challenge Fund (MCF), the project aims to encourage better driver behaviour by creating a better network of modern safety cameras, […]

New speed cameras for the A32 and A272 in Hampshire installed

Hampshire’s Police and Crime Commissioner has announced the installation of eight average speed cameras along two of what she calls the most problematic roads for excessive noise and speeding in the county. Donna Jones says the A32 and A272 in the Meon Valley have been subject to excessive motorbike noise and speeding for a number […]

Man fined for abusing speed camera operator

A man from Bradford has been fined more than £500 after admitting to a public order offence against a Safety Camera van operator. Last August, 24 year old Hamzah Mahmood stopped his vehicle which blocked the safety camera van and then verbally abused the operator.  The man, from Queens Road in Bradford, was arrested and […]

Scottish MSP pleads for speed cameras

An MSP is calling for a change in the criteria for placing average speed cameras on roads as he makes a plea for the technology to be added to the A75. The Daily Record reports that, while speaking in a Holyrood debate, Galloway and West Dumfries member Finlay Carson highlighted issues in Crocketford and Springholm, […]

Guernsey moves closer to speed camera introduction

The States of Guernsey is looking for contractors to review the island’s management of traffic offences. The BBC reports the Government on the Channel Island hope introducing a points-based system and fixed cameras will improve road safety. It says it also aims to reduce resources and time police and courts spent on speed offences and […]

Average speed cameras to go live in north west Coventry

Coventry City Council has announced more average speed enforcement cameras will start operating in the city in the coming weeks. Equipment from enforcement firm Jenoptik has been installed on lamp columns along Tamworth Road which will be able to measure the average speed of motorists. The speed cameras will register the average speed of drivers […]

M4 cameras to start leading to fines

Speed cameras on the M4 in South Wales will start issuing fines this month, more than a year after they were installed. The BBC reports the cameras cover the 50mph stretch of road around Newport, but drivers have escaped prosecution up to now. The Welsh government has set a date for the cameras to start […]
